Nagarjuna Const bags 2 contracts

Hyderabad, July 18

Nagarjuna Construction Company Ltd has announced that the company has been awarded two projects valued at Rs 236 crore. The first project valued at Rs 200 crore relates to a reservoir at Nandyal in Kurnool district, while the second worth Rs 36 crore is for the construction of multi-storied apartments by Shriram Properties Ltd at Sadashivanagar, Bangalore, according to a company press release. —
